Main Causes of Playground Accidents

  • Playground does not meet standards requirements
  • Installation differs from the original design intent
  • Presence of other obstacles not considered during the design stage
  • Play equipment are damaged or not properly maintained
  • Less then adequate of surface impact absorption in case of falls
  • Protruding edges and sharp points

Playground Risk Management Plan

  • A playground Safety Policy approved by the Management is needed to establish the standard of care and emphasize the owner’s commitment to playground safety. Resources will be provided to minimize exposure to risk and make playground related safety decisions.
  • Identify and appoint a Playground Safety Coordinator to facilitate the owner’s commitment to playground safety. The Coordinator is responsible to ensure the playground is maintained and inspected according to plan and respond to the continually changing playground environments
  • Maintain the historical and updated Playground related documentations such as the manufacturer’s documents and any other inhouse documents (site plans, audit & inspection reports, incident reports, maintenance records, etc)
  • A Playground safety audit is to be conducted before the opening of a new playground or when there is a change of condition such as new equipment or surfacing. A hazard priority rating should be applied for all non-compliant conditions based on predictable results. Audit report shall record findings onsite using site plan, photographs and any other appropriate materials. Immediate action must be taken for Priority One Hazards
  • Inspections and Maintenance plan will further ensure playground safety and keep playground equipment function. New hazards may be introduced resulting from wear & tear, vandalism, litter and/or other environmental conditions. Regular and continual inspection of Playground allow the identification of playground safety issues before any children gets injured.

Our Playground Safety Program is made to comply with SS 457:2017 Specification for playground equipment for Public Use and ASTM F1487-17 Standard Consumer Safety Performance Specification for Playground Equipment for Public.

Home playground equipment, toys, amusement rides, sports equipment, fitness equipment intended for users over the age of 12, public use play equipment for children 6 to 24 months, and soft contained play equipment are not included in this program.
